    Next, download the following to the Desktop:
    VundoFix.exe
    * Double-click VundoFix.exe to run it
    * Click: Scan for Vundo
    * Once done scanning, click: Remove Vundo
    * A prompt asking if you want to remove the files appears, click: Yes
    * The Desktop goes blank as it starts removing Vundo.
    * When completed, a prompt to shutdown the computer appears, click OK
    * Turn the computer back on.

    A log is created and found in C:\vundofix.txt
